It’s best to look at your boiler’s user manual to be sure where your … charge gameboy sp without chargerWeb20 apr. 2006 · Check for air in the expansion tank by lightly touching it. Normally, the bottom half of the tank feels warmer than the top; if the tank feels hot all over, it has filled with water and must be drained. Here's how to drain an expansion tank: Turn off power to boiler. Close water supply shutoff valve, and let tank cool. charge galaxy s9 without chargerWebHot Water Boiler Expansion Tanks.
